About Work Permit Law in Chiriqui, Panama

The Work Permit law in Chiriqui, Panama, is governed by the Ministry of Labor and Workforce Development. As in other parts of the country, to work in Chiriqui, you need a work permit if you are a foreign individual. This permit allows for legal employment in the region and is required to ensure the legitimacy of the employer-employee relationship. The type of work permit you need can differ based on the type of job, your nationality, and the length of your stay.

Local Laws Overview

In Chiriqui, Panama, as in the rest of the country, local laws enforce how work permits are issued. These laws dictate that foreign individuals must have a job offer from a recognized employer in Panama for their work permit to be approved. Furthermore, under the local laws, the employer needs to justify the employment of foreign nationals over local residents, explaining why the job cannot be performed by a Panamanian person.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How long does it take to get a work permit in Chiriqui, Panama?

The timeline for obtaining a work permit can be variable depending upon the complexity of the case. However, it can take anywhere from a few weeks to several months to receive a work permit after application.

2. Can I work anywhere with my work permit in Chiriqui?

No, in most cases, your work permit is valid only for the job and location specified in your application.

3. Do I have to renew my work permit?

Yes, your work permit is valid for a limited length of time. Upon expiry, the permit has to be renewed in accordance with local laws.

4. Can my permit be revoked?

Yes, the Ministry of Labor and Workforce Development can revoke your work permit if it believes you have violated any conditions of the permit or other labor laws.

5. Can a lawyer help speed up the permit application process?

A lawyer with expertise in this area can help to ensure all the necessary documents are correctly filed, potentially speeding up the process. However, the final decision lies with the Ministry of Labor and Workforce Development.
